Definition of Imbosom
Im`bos´om
v. t.
1.
To
hold
in
the
bosom
;
to
cherish
in
the
heart
or
affection
;
to
embosom
.
[
imp
. &
p
.
p
.
Imbosomed
;
p
.
pr
. &
vb
.
n
.
Imbosoming
.]
2.
To
inclose
or
place
in
the
midst
of
;
to
surround
or
shelter
;
as
,
a
house
imbosomed
in
a
grove
.
The
Father
infinite
,
By
whom
in
bliss
imbosomed
sat
the
Son
.
- Milton.
